I have so many filaments, I decided to design a Filament Storage Rack to display my filaments in order. Then I made it.

 

I bought some Aluminum tubes(Outer Diameter 20mm, Inner Diameter 15mm), 1 meter in length as the crossbar(You can customize the length to your needs, but I didn't test the aluminum tube that exceeds 1 meter), and printed the rack model in PLA-CF, the foot in TPU to avoid scratching the desktop(Whether you need this part or not is up to you).

 

The first level needs 2 Aluminum tubes, PLA-CF 668g(Shelves on both sides), TPU 52g( foot), and add 1 level needs  2 Aluminum tubes, PLA-CF 668g(Shelves on both sides),  140g PLA-CF(For filaments with spool) or 270g PLA-CF(For filaments with package). Because the filaments with packages need a higher height.
